Why Are Stand Mixers Essential for Successful Baking?
Stand mixers are essential for successful baking because they provide efficient mixing, consistent results, and reduce physical labor. They combine ingredients more thoroughly than manual mixing, leading to better texture and flavor in baked goods.
According to the American Culinary Federation, a leading organization for culinary professionals, stand mixers are defined as “electrical appliances that use a motor to rotate a set of beaters in a bowl containing food ingredients.” This tool is an invaluable asset in both home and professional kitchens.
The importance of stand mixers in baking stems from their ability to evenly blend ingredients, which is crucial for creating uniform doughs and batters. When flour, sugar, fats, and liquids are thoroughly mixed, baked goods achieve the desired structure and taste. Stand mixers can also handle tougher doughs, like bread, which require extensive kneading. This kneading develops gluten, the protein responsible for the elasticity and chewiness of bread.
Technical terms involved include “gluten formation” and “emulsification.” Gluten formation occurs when wheat flour is mixed with water, creating a network of proteins that trap gas during fermentation. Emulsification refers to the process of combining liquids that usually do not mix, such as oil and water. Stand mixers excel at these processes by maintaining consistent speed and power, ensuring thorough blending.
Specific conditions that contribute to successful baking include accurate measurements of ingredients and proper mixing time. For instance, under-mixing a cake batter may lead to a dense texture. Over-mixing, on the other hand, can toughen cookies due to excessive gluten development. Stand mixers allow for precise control; users can set speeds and mixing times to achieve optimal results consistently. For example, when making meringue, the stand mixer can whip egg whites quickly to the stiff peak stage without the risk of over-whipping.

How Can You Maximize the Use of Your Kitchen Mixer for Baking Success?
To maximize the use of your kitchen mixer for baking success, focus on mastering its various functions, selecting appropriate attachments, maintaining proper mixing techniques, and understanding ingredient preparation.
Mastering functions: Kitchen mixers have multiple settings that help you achieve desired results. For example, the speed control allows for precise mixing. Starting on a low setting prevents ingredient splatter. Gradually increasing speed ensures thorough blending while maintaining texture.
Selecting attachments: Different mixer attachments serve specific purposes. The flat beater is ideal for cookie and cake batters. The whisk attachment works well for incorporating air in egg whites or cream. The dough hook is designed for kneading bread dough efficiently. Understanding each attachment’s role can enhance your baking process.
Maintaining proper mixing techniques: Mixing techniques are critical for quality. Combine wet and dry ingredients separately before mixing to achieve even texture. Avoid overmixing batters, as this can lead to dense results. According to a study by Hensley (2020), overmixing can develop gluten too much, negatively affecting baked goods.
Understanding ingredient preparation: Ingredient temperature can impact mixing performance. Using room temperature butter results in better creaming when making cakes. Chilled ingredients are preferable for flaky pie crusts. The correct preparation of ingredients can significantly improve your baking outcomes.
Being mindful of cleanup: A mixer can produce a mess if not used correctly. To avoid this, ensure the bowl is secured properly. Use a splash guard if available. Easy cleanup ensures you can focus on enjoying the baking process rather than dreading the aftermath.
By utilizing these strategies, you can enhance the efficiency and effectiveness of your kitchen mixer, leading to better baking results.
